  • Water and extreme winds detected on exoplanet

    On the exoplanet WASP-127b, over 500 light years away, wind speeds can reach 33,000 kilometres per hour, according to a study by an international team of scientists. This is the first time winds of this type have been detected and it has been possible thanks to an instrument partly built at Uppsala University. The study is published in Astronomy & Astrophysics.

  • Route of entry for Semliki Forest virus into the brain revealed

    A recent study shows that the Semliki Forest virus enters the central nervous system by first entering the cerebrospinal fluid and then binding to a specific cell type before penetrating deeper into the brain. This finding could potentially be used to develop the Semliki Forest virus as an agent for treating brain cancer. The study has been published in the journal Nature Communications.

  • Different menopausal hormone treatments pose different risks

    Researchers have analysed the effects of seven different hormone treatments for menopausal symptoms, and the risk of blood clots, stroke and heart attack. The risks differ depending on the active substance and how the medicine is taken. The study involves around one million women aged 50-58 and is the largest and most comprehensive study of currently prescribed hormonal substances in the world.

  • Fossil dung reveals clues to dinosaur success story

    In an international collaboration, researchers at Uppsala University have been able to identify undigested food remains, plants and prey in the fossilised faeces of dinosaurs. These analyses of hundreds of samples provide clues about the role dinosaurs played in the ecosystem around 200 million years ago. The findings have been published in the journal Nature.

  • Patients may become unnecessarily depressed by common heart medicine

    All patients who have had a heart attack are typically treated using beta blockers. According to a Swedish study conducted earlier this year, this drug is unlikely to be needed for those heart patients who have a normal pumping ability. Now a sub-study at Uppsala University shows that there is also a risk that these patients will become depressed by the treatment.

  • Early prostate cancer surgery extended life

    The survival rate of men with prostate cancer who had their entire prostate gland removed immediately after the tumour was detected increased by 17 percentage points compared with those who did not have treatment until the tumour began to cause symptoms. On average, they also lived more than two years longer. These are the final results of a 30-year Scandinavian study led from Uppsala University.

  • PTSD symptoms can be reduced through treatment including a video game

    A single treatment session, which includes the video game Tetris, can reduce symptoms of post-traumatic stress disorder (PTSD), shows a new study carried out with healthcare professionals working during the COVID-19 pandemic. The results are published in BMC Medicine. The study involved 164 participants, and the positive effects persisted after five weeks and even six months after treatment.

  • Are cows pickier than goats?

    To answer this question, Linnaeus collected 643 different plant species that were then fed to horses, cows, pigs, sheep and goats. The results were carefully compiled but not analysed until now, 275 years later, when they are also published by the Linnean Society in London.
